Shakespeare’s masterpiece of the turbulence of war and the arts of peace tells the romantic story of Henry’s campaign to recapture the English possessions in France. But the ambitions of this charismatic king are challenged by a host of vivid characters caught up in the real horrors of war. Henry V, which opened the new Globe with the words ‘O for a muse of fire’, celebrates the power of language to summon into life courts, pubs, ships and battlefields within the ‘wooden O’ - and beyond.

🎬 MovieFinder's Take

This Globe production constructs its power from the raw, unamplified voice and the palpable energy of a live audience. It relies on Shakespeare's text and the actors' physicality to explore the duality of war—its rousing patriotism and its visceral cost.

What lingers after the curtain call is the immediacy of the performance, a reminder of theatre's primal ability to conjure ships, courts, and battlefields with words alone. — MovieFinder Editorial
